Transaction 62abf2899cd5bbbfb6991c96cef1176b2a9fe10077560709c2d401e50a87543a

2 Input
2 Outputs
  • 62abf2899cd5bbbfb6991c96cef1176b2a9fe10077560709c2d401e50a87543a:0
  • value  960951
    address  16VuGmuSPrRseuXTXvS91VpwHgPYkGqTY2
  • 62abf2899cd5bbbfb6991c96cef1176b2a9fe10077560709c2d401e50a87543a:1
  • value  526705
    address  bc1qfvjs0plkdcm7uwaeetfn85628eayr235hxmyw5